Hi



The graph shows the PSRR for bandgap with filter at the power supply VDD33A.



The red colour is the frequency response of the filter with 35 KHz bandwidth.
The blue colour is PSR for Bandgap itself.
The pink colour is the combination of power supply filter and bandgap.


The worst PSR is at 23 KHz with -30 dB. The peaking of the filter is quite high.



Is it ok the PSR for the bandgap from the graph?
 

The PSRR is enough or not depending on you spec. The problem is why you use such supply filter? where is peak ffrom?
 

To improve high-frequency PSRR? For generally application, it is enough.
